While moving Ventosa (hull 383) to a new marina yesterday, the bearing developed a high pitch squeal above 2000 RPMs. Ventosa was on her first trip after being laid up for the winter. Thru hull for water to the bearing is open. Anyone have an idea about what may be going on? Not sure if it is related but did find some black soot like debri in the large starboard lazarette upon arrival in port.

Just curious if you have "burped" the seal lately. Air can be trapped in the PSS especially if the boat just came out of the water, or if a diver was under the boat, or just small debris may have build up in the area between the shaft bearing and the seal.
Just pull the bellows back for a couple of seconds and let the water flush the seal out and see if it makes a difference.

Don, I think Dave has a water injected dripless shaft seal. Usually these do not require burping but there may be a small pocket of air causing the squealing. It probably wouldn't hurt to burp it just in case.
